Other Hospitality Administration/Management is the 516th most popular major in the country with 772 degrees awarded in 2020-2021.

Across the Southeast region, there were 40 other hospitality administration/management gra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the associate degree level specifically, there were 1 other hospitality administration/management graduates with average earnings and debt of $34,328 and $20,384 respectively.
